The Northolme home of Gainsborough Trinity. Was a league ground from 1896 to 1912. One stand facing south so you get blinded watching the Saturday afternoon matches. One open terrace for away fans with an unmanned gate and two other very shallow terraces. Official capacity 4009 but Lincolnshire police never let them sell more than 3000 tickets yet they had nearly 9000 for a match in the 60's. Love the ground, close to the town centre, can choose where you stand, only £1 extra to sit, chips (if you want) from kiosk at half time and Blues Club ( who own the ground) next door for a quick drink beforehand but it meets the criteria to be on this list.

Glanford Park - the move to a new stadium was the idea of the previous owner who claimed he found a mess when he took over the running of the club only to take them out of the league and down to Conference North. He put a charge on the ground for all the money he said he had lost over the years and at one point the directors announced they were moving ground (a month into the eason) to Gainsborough Trinity (Northolme) 14 miles away before government money bought Glanford Park. The stadium is way outside the town effectively on an industrial estate and was called "Glanford Park" as it was originally sponsored by Glanford Council which no longer exists.
